I tested 8.3beta4 with DBT-3 (TPC-H) and found unstable selection of plans.
Planner randomly selected two types of plans (A, B) when I repeated EXPLAIN.

One of the conditions is used in Seq Scan Filter in Plan A. In contrast,
the same condition is used in Hash Join filter in Plan B. Plan A is
faster than B because the condition is used early. Cost of the plan A is
also cheap then B (A:307307.47 vs. B:351706.51).

Where did the randomness come from? Are there large randomness in planner?
I wonder why the worse plan is picked in spite of significantly different costs.

---- Outline of Plan A ----
 Hash Join
   -> Seq Scan
        Filter: (*condition*)
   -> Hash
        -> Seq Scan

---- Outline of Plan B  ----
 Hash Join
    Join Filter: (*condition*)
    -> Seq Scan
    -> Hash
         -> Seq Scan
